I really hate to sound so ignorant here, but I need to know what an AIFF file is. I have an audition that I have voiced (I have to pay for studio time until I get a mic and USB mixer) and would like to send it in, but they only want an AIF file. I'm using Audacity (becuase it's free) and can't find a way to export it in that format; only in MP3 or WAV. I appreciate any help anyone can offer.

Hello Larry,
With Audacity you can export files in different formats, in this case you could export as WAVE and convert the files to Aiff using iTunes. iTunes will give you the option to export as a high quality Aiff.
